I made a litle plugin for helping me to generate thumbnails fast.
Basically allows you to define a grid of thumbnails and define a “thumbnail session” (with X time for each thumbnail), and the plugin manage to change automatically (or manually) every region/thumbnail, so you can focus simply on drawing and generate ideas fast.
It also comes with an action for selecting a random brush preset (this is useful for experimenting, coming up with different textures/shapes for each thumbnail, and kinda to “embrace serendipity”).
The cases I use this is for generating ideas before making any ilustration. The plugin just help me to keep the flow while I’m painting.
Yes, it makes “small canvases” (but that is good for thumbnails). It was inspired by some lessons by Stephan (Wootha) Richard that I personally highly recommend.

Two tips for anyone who enjoys using the “randomize brush” setting:
Open the docker called brush preset history. Clear it if it’s already open from another session. This gives you a list of all the brushes used (in case you stumble upon one that you love).
If you don’t like the random brush that came up, click the “random brush” button and you’ll be presented with a different one.

Sorry for my ignorance, does this create the painted thumbnail or just empty ones to paint in?
When I found this plug-in i thought about “Alchemy” ( https://al.chemy.org/) and thought it produced Random thumbnail images to inspire artwork. Maybe someone smart (@Suzuka) could look at making something like this?
Hi @Barry_De_Beer ,as per my experience this plug creates empty selections (based on the provided sub division details) with a customizable auto timer system,Where you can also avail an extra option of random auto brush selection,“decided” by the plug in.
